    Real Benefits for Your Home

    Future-Proof Specification

    Exceeds current and anticipated Building Regulations for thermal performance.

    Reduced Condensation

    Warmer inner surfaces mean condensation is virtually eliminated.

    Available Across Full Range

    Triple glazing is available in casement, tilt & turn, sash and fixed window styles.

    Maximum Thermal Insulation

    U-values as low as 0.8 W/m²K — significantly outperforming even the best double glazing.

    Superior Noise Reduction

    Three panes with two cavities provide exceptional acoustic insulation.

    Before You Decide

    Will Triple Glazing Make Rooms Darker?

    No. Modern low-e coatings are virtually transparent. Triple-glazed windows let in almost as much light as double-glazed, while blocking significantly more heat loss.

    Can I Mix Double and Triple in the Same House?

    Yes. Many homeowners triple-glaze north-facing and exposed rooms while using A-rated double glazing elsewhere — a cost-effective compromise.

    Are Triple-Glazed Windows Heavier?

    Yes, slightly. Modern frames and hardware are designed for the extra weight. Our uPVC and aluminium systems handle triple-glazed units without any operational issues.

    Is Triple Glazing Really Worth the Extra Cost?

    For north-facing, exposed or noise-affected properties, absolutely. Triple glazing costs 30-40% more than double but delivers significantly better thermal and acoustic performance. For well-sheltered south-facing homes, A-rated double glazing may be sufficient.
